
"Wencito's Drawings" is a picture story book for children with a poem at the end of the story.
It tells the story of Wencito, a little boy with a big imagination who loves to draw. The story teaches young children how to value imagination, and how to never give up. The book also teaches art appreciation and basic poetry, while featuring
within it's illustrations the authentic artwork of a two year old toddler. The black and white illustrations combined with boldly colored artwork
are eye catching to young children.
